Rebecca Galbraith is a Senior Lecturer in the School of Architecture, Art and Design at the University of Portsmouth, Faculty of Creative & Cultural Industries. She leads the undergraduate and postgraduate Degree Apprenticeship programs and coordinates the Technology and Professional Practice module for the Master of Architecture program, while also tutoring on Part 3 case studies and BA/MArch dissertations.

Her research focuses on architectural pedagogy, ethics in architectural education, spatial and performance practices, and the role of painting in understanding landscape and place. She emphasizes experiential learning and the integration of professional practice into academic training. Her work explores how architecture can foster deeper human experiences before design solutions are applied.
Rebecca’s practice-based research includes artistic residencies and collaborative design projects, such as the 'Portsmouth Phoenix' initiative and her 2023 SpudWORKS residency in the New Forest. She connects artistic inquiry with architectural understanding, using painting as a method of embodied knowledge. Her teaching philosophy bridges academia and industry through degree apprenticeships, strengthening links with architectural practice.

Rebecca supervises undergraduate and postgraduate dissertations and has been involved in organizing and presenting at academic events such as the CCI Research and Innovation Conference and the AHRA International Conference. She is actively involved in the artistic community as a practicing artist and member of Yard Studios in Winchester. Her projects, such as 'Friday at the Yard' and the SpudWORKS residency, reflect her interest in embodied knowledge, habitual practices, and the intersection of art and architecture.
